Magento bin/magento parse error with Wamp

I'm new to MAgento and I have some trouble executing the magento command.

When I'm using

C:/my-project-root/bin/magento setup:upgrade

I have the following error :

Parse error: syntax error, unexpected 'try' (T_TRY) in C:\my-project-root\bin\magento on line 13

I'm with Wampserver, PHP version 5.6.31, but I run this command from the PHP7.0.23 directory because of Magento requisitie.

I've take a look at the forum to solve it, but there is no way...

When I change my PHP folder in the PATH to PHP7.0.23 the result is the same..

Anyone has an idea ?

Thank a lot

What I personnaly do is actually specify what php executable file I use with its relevant config (ini file).

go to your magento folder

cd C:\my-project-root\www\ ;

use the php 7 executable, with its relevant ini config file.

WARNING , the below example should be adapted with YOUR correct file paths

C:\wamp\bin\php\php-7.0.4-Win32-VC14-x86\php.exe -c "C:\wamp\bin\php\php-7.0.4-Win32-VC14-x86\php.ini" C:\my-project-root\bin\magento setup:upgrade
